Both sides now: McGarvey gets top TV role

Beverley McGarvey has landed the top job at Paramount’s Network 10, following the departure of Jarrod Villani after three years sharing roles.

McGarvey has been appointed president of Network 10, head of streaming and regional lead for Australia and New Zealand. Previously, both she and Villani held ANZ executive vice president roles, he as chief operating & commercial officer & regional lead, Paramount ANZ, and she as chief content officer & head of Paramount+.

The change is immediate and comes as Paramount told staff of redundancies as part of a global cut of 800 jobs, about three per cent of its workforce.

The two had previously worked together within their individual responsibilities, consulting together on major decisions. Now Paramount Global says as president of Network 10, head of streaming and regional lead for Australia and New Zealand, effective immediately, McGarvey will have both commercial and creative leadership of the multi-platform business in Australia, with oversight of Network 10 and its portfolio of brands, including 10 Play.

She will retain current responsibilities, overseeing all original content from Australia, working with Paramount’s global studio organisation and the businesses’ commercial capabilities.

President and chief executive of international markets Pam Kaufman said McGarvey (pictured) had a proven track record of driving creative and commercial success. “With Beverley at the helm, we are well-positioned to maintain our strong position in Australia as the only global media company with a successful free-to-air network and powerful free and paid streaming platforms, powered by our global content pipeline and our range of originally produced Australian shows.”
